Ticket CAT-904 — Nightly catalogue import from the Ferndale Consortium fails signature verification since the 12th. The feed itself parses fine; the verifier rejects the detached signature because our trust store still holds the expired entry. Replace it and replay the failed runs. The consortium's current signing key is below.

signing key of baduf-taweg = bky6_Zf7bem

Quick notes for whoever inherits this. The exam-proctoring queue (codename Hallmonitor) pulls sessions from the Proctorly intake service using a dedicated service account, not personal creds — learned that the hard way after Dmitri left and everything broke. The account needs read on the intake topic and write on the flagged-events topic, nothing more. Rotation happens quarterly-ish; check the runbook. If the queue stalls, nine times out of ten it's an auth failure. The current key for the intake service is below.

API key for yahig-tadup: kto7_ubizbYm

Fan-out backpressure for the Quillet notifier: when the queue depth crosses the soft limit, the dispatcher sheds low-priority pushes and batches the rest at 500ms intervals. Reviewer should confirm the shed counter is exported and that retries respect the jitter window. Once merged, the release artifact gets re-signed by the pipeline, which expects the deploy key shown below.

deploy key for bawep-yawif: bky6_GQhaSt

Ticket: Telemetry payloads from the Windrose agent are shipped uncompressed, averaging 180KB per batch. Proposal: gzip at level 6 before POST, with a content-encoding header the collector already accepts. Benchmarks show ~85% reduction and negligible CPU cost on the agent. Reviewer: please check the fallback path when the collector rejects compressed bodies — we must not drop batches. Tests cover round-trip and fallback. The change is verified against the build noted below.

trace token, fafog-kageg: htk4_98e6

Welcome to the Larkspur planner team!

Quick context for the weekly sync: we shipped a query planner regression in 3.8 where join reordering picks nested loops on wide tables, so p95 latency tripled on the Harwick cluster. The hotfix hides the new reorderer behind a flag. To reproduce locally, set PLANNER_REORDER_V2=false in your env file and replay the captured workload from the bench bucket. The replay tool talks to the metrics gateway and needs its auth secret in the env file, added on the very next line.

sealed setting: ARCHIVE_KEY3=8d0